captnhoy Posted April 28, 2015 Share Posted April 28, 2015 For what it's worth - Today was my 8th time to extend my stay based on retirement. Here is what I saw that was new in my own experience. I had to make passport copies of my entire history of permission to stay spanning about 12 or so photocopies. Previously it was only for the prior year. I had to sign 3 documents that I had not seen before - 1) a statement that I understand the rules of staying, 2) permission to share my details and 3) a statement concerning any involvement in criminal justice system or court cases within Thailand. I have no history with law enforcement but for people who do there was space for writing the details, case numbers etc. I provided the usual 2 photos and they proceeded to take my photo using equipment the same as at the airport which I had never seen before. Also new to me I had to provide a hand drawn map to my residence. Unlike some other offices I did not have to wait fro approval from some other location. After about an hour of processing I did walk out with a new stamp good until this time next year. I took the Admiral with me (Thai wife) and the office staff spoke to her about being excited about their upcoming days off. They said to her that the Ranong office would be closed for sure on the 2nd, 3rd, 4th and 5th. They were hoping that the PM would also give them the 1st and were waiting to see if that would happen. Perhaps this is because Ranong is not so big but I think it underscores that your mileage may vary depending upon where you report no matter what the official news is.
